Made in America
Tervis tumblers have been proudly made in America since 1946. Invented and perfected by Detroit engineers Frank Cotter and G. Howlett Davis, according to Tervis.com, “The Donelly family purchased the Tervis product rights in the 1950s and incorporated the Tervis Tumbler Company in 1967. To this day, all Tervis products are proudly made in North Venice, Florida, where over 600 people are employed through this family-owned-and-operated business.” Better still, living in SW Florida makes Tervis an awesome local product for this featured publisher, woo hoo!
In addition, the tumblers are microwave*, freezer, and dishwasher safe, perfect for travel and of course customizable! *Certain designs are not microwavable.
